mercaptobenzothiazole

English

Etymology

From mercapto- +‎ benzothiazole.

Noun

mercaptobenzothiazole (countable and uncountable, plural mercaptobenzothiazoles)

  1. (organic chemistry) An organosulfur compound, C6H4(NH)SC=S, used in the sulfur vulcanization of rubber.
    Synonym: (initialism) MBT
